KEY INGREDIENTS IN RANCH GARLIC PARMESAN CHICKEN SKEWERS

Before firing up the grill, let’s break down the core ingredients that make these skewers so unforgettable. Each component plays its role—some build the salty, cheesy base, others bring that fresh herb vibe, and a few ensure the chicken stays tender and juicy. Grab your apron and take a quick tour through the pantry essentials:

  • Boneless, skinless chicken breasts

Tender and lean, these chicken cubes soak up the marinade beautifully, ensuring every bite is juicy without extra fat or gristle.

  • Ranch dressing

This creamy foundation infuses the chicken with a tangy blend of herbs like dill and chives, offering that signature ranch flavor in every succulent morsel.

  • Olive oil

A smooth, fruity carrier that helps distribute flavors evenly and prevents the chicken from drying out on the grill.

  • Garlic

Minced for maximum punch, garlic adds a fragrant, savory depth that pairs perfectly with the creaminess of the ranch and Parmesan cheese.

  • Parmesan cheese

Its nutty, salty personality melts into the marinade, lending a rich umami boost and a delightful crust when grilled.

  • Dried Italian seasoning

A classic herb blend that layers in oregano, basil, and thyme, bringing a whisper of sunshine to each skewer.

  • Onion powder

A subtle aromatic that enhances savory notes without overpowering the garlic or cheese.

  • Salt

The ultimate flavor enhancer, it ensures the chicken absorbs every nuance of the marinade.

  • Black pepper

Freshly ground for a mild kick, rounding out the seasoning profile with a touch of warmth.

  • Wooden or metal skewers

The essential vessels for grilling—wooden ones benefit from a soak to prevent burning, while metal skewers are reusable and heat-conductive.

HOW TO MAKE RANCH GARLIC PARMESAN CHICKEN SKEWERS

Let’s talk about the journey from raw ingredients to those delectable, charred skewers you’ll be serving. Follow these steps for a foolproof method that maximizes flavor and keeps the chicken irresistibly tender.

1. In a medium bowl, combine ranch dressing, olive oil, minced garlic, grated Parmesan cheese, dried Italian seasoning, onion powder, salt, and black pepper. Stir vigorously with a whisk or fork until all elements are fully incorporated and the marinade is smooth.

2. Add the chicken cubes to the bowl and gently toss until every piece is generously coated in the ranch-Parmesan mixture. Once evenly covered, cover the bowl with plastic wrap or a lid and refrigerate for at least 1 hour, allowing the flavors to deeply marinate the meat.

3. If you’re using wooden skewers, soak them in water for at least 30 minutes. This simple step prevents the wood from charring or splintering when you place them on the hot grill.

4. Preheat your grill to medium-high heat—aim for a surface temperature around 375–400°F. This ensures a sear that locks in juices while producing those signature grill marks.

5. Thread the marinated chicken pieces onto the skewers, spacing them evenly without overcrowding. Proper spacing allows hot air and smoke to circulate, creating an even cook and that irresistible grilled texture.

6. Place the skewers on the preheated grill grates and cook for about 12–15 minutes, turning every few minutes. Look for a slight char on each side and check that the internal temperature has reached 165°F (75°C) for safe, juicy perfection.

7. Remove the skewers from the grill and let them rest for a few minutes. Serve hot, garnished with extra grated Parmesan if desired, and get ready to enjoy every mouthwatering bite.

HOW TO STORE RANCH GARLIC PARMESAN CHICKEN SKEWERS

Ensuring these skewers stay just as delicious the next day is easier than you might think. Store them properly to maintain texture and flavor, so you can enjoy that creamy, garlicky-parmesan magic even as leftovers.

  • Refrigerate in an Airtight Container

After the skewers have cooled to room temperature, transfer them to a sealed container. They’ll keep their moisture and tangy flavor for up to 3 days when stored this way.

  • Freeze for Longer Storage

Lay the skewers flat on a baking sheet and flash-freeze for about 1–2 hours. Then trans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container, separating layers with parchment paper. They’ll stay fresh for up to 2 months.

  • Thaw Safely

Move frozen skewers to the refrigerator the night before you plan to reheat. Slow thawing helps preserve both juiciness and the integrity of the marinade.

  • Reheat Gently

For best results, reheat in a preheated oven at 350°F for 10–12 minutes or on the grill over low heat until warmed through. This method prevents the chicken from drying out and revives that delightful char.

Frequently Asked Questions

Expand All:

How long does it take to prepare this recipe?

The preparation time for the Ranch Garlic Parmesan Chicken Skewers is approximately 30 minutes. This includes cutting the chicken into cubes, preparing the marinade, and letting the chicken marinate for at least 1 hour in the refrigerator to enhance the flavor.

Can I use other types of meat or vegetables for this recipe?

Yes, you can substitute the chicken with other meats such as turkey or shrimp. Additionally, you can add vegetables like bell peppers, zucchini, or cherry tomatoes to the skewers. Just ensure that any meat is cooked to the appropriate internal temperature, and adjust cooking times for vegetables accordingly.

What is the best way to store leftovers from this dish?

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. To reheat, you can use a microwave, or place them back on the grill or oven until warmed through. Be sure to check that the internal temperature reaches 165°F (75°C) when reheating.

Can these skewers be cooked on the stovetop if I don’t have a grill?

Yes! If you don’t have access to a grill, you can cook these skewers in your oven by broiling them on high. Place the skewers on a baking sheet lined with aluminum foil for easier cleanup, and broil for approximately 12-15 minutes, turning occasionally until the chicken is fully cooked.
